Keypad & Keyless Entry in Las Vegas

When your keypad or keyless entry system stops working, it’s more than an inconvenience — it can leave you locked out of your own vehicle in the Las Vegas heat. Keypad entry systems (like the factory keypads on Ford, Lincoln, and other models) rely on a small circuit board and membrane buttons that can fail due to sun exposure, dust, or repeated use. Keyless entry remotes and proximity fobs use radio frequencies to communicate with your car’s receiver, but that receiver can lose sync, the fob can stop transmitting, or the internal antenna can break. The work involved includes diagnosing the specific failure — whether it’s a dead fob battery, a corroded keypad connection, a faulty receiver module, or a programming issue — then repairing or replacing the affected component. For keypads, that often means removing the door panel, testing the wiring harness, and installing a new OEM or aftermarket keypad that matches your vehicle’s security system. For keyless remotes, it means reprogramming the fob to the car’s computer, replacing the internal battery or circuit board, or repairing the antenna module that picks up the signal.

Why does this matter specifically in Las Vegas? The extreme summer temperatures can warp keypad casings and weaken solder joints on circuit boards. Dust from construction and desert winds can get into keypad buttons, making them unresponsive. And the high number of rental cars, fleet vehicles, and second-hand cars in the valley means many keyless entry systems have been reprogrammed multiple times or are running on old batteries. What to Expect

When you call for keypad or keyless entry service, here’s what happens: we arrive at your location with the necessary diagnostic tools and replacement parts. We test your keypad or fob to identify the exact issue — dead battery, broken circuit, programming error, or receiver failure. For keypad repairs, we remove the door panel, replace the keypad unit, and program your custom code. For keyless remotes, we reprogram the fob to your vehicle’s computer and test all functions (lock, unlock, trunk, panic). If the receiver module is faulty, we can replace it on-site. The entire process typically takes 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the vehicle. We use quality parts and ensure everything works before we leave.
